Discover the Serenity of Skien Sluse (Telemarkskanalen)

Skien Sluse, part of the renowned Telemarkskanalen, invites visitors to experience the enchanting beauty of Norway's waterways. This historic site serves as a lock system that connects various lakes and rivers, showcasing the impressive engineering feats of the past. As you arrive, you'll be greeted by the scenic views of the lush surrounding landscapes, making it a perfect backdrop for photography enthusiasts or those simply wanting to soak in nature's splendor. The area is rich in history, and while walking along the canals, you can learn about the significance of the Telemark Canal in Norway's transportation history. The Sluse is not just a functional lock; it's a gateway to exploring the serene waterways that have long been used for trade and leisure. Budding historians and casual visitors alike will appreciate the informative signs and local guides who enrich the experience with tales of the past. For those looking to engage in outdoor activities, the Sluse is surrounded by beautiful walking trails and opportunities for boating. Whether you choose to rent a kayak, take a leisurely boat ride, or simply enjoy a peaceful stroll, Skien Sluse provides a refreshing escape from the hustle and bustle of daily life. Getting There

  • Car

    If you're traveling by car, head towards Skien via the E18 motorway. From Oslo, take E18 south towards Drammen, and then continue on E18 towards Skien. Take the exit for Rv36 towards Skien. Follow Rv36 to Skien city center. Once in Skien, use local roads to navigate to Bruene 6, where Skien Sluse (Telemarkskanalen) is located. Parking may be available nearby, but check for any parking fees.

  • Public Transportation (Bus)

    To reach Skien Sluse by public transportation, take a bus to Skien from major cities like Oslo or Porsgrunn. Bus services such as Vy offer routes to Skien. Once you arrive at Skien Bus Station, head towards Bruene 6, which is approximately a 15-minute walk. Follow the signs to the city center and ask locals for directions to Skien Sluse if needed.

  • Public Transportation (Train)

    If you're traveling by train, take a train from Oslo or other nearby cities to Skien Station. Check Vy for train schedules. Upon arrival at Skien Station, it is about a 20-minute walk to Skien Sluse. Exit the station and head towards the city center, following the signs to Bruene 6. You can also catch a local bus if you prefer not to walk.

  • Local Transport (Taxi or Ride-share)

    For a convenient option, consider taking a taxi or using a ride-share service from your location in Skien to Skien Sluse. This is especially useful if you have luggage or prefer a quick trip. Taxi fares may vary depending on the distance, but expect to pay around 100-200 NOK for a short ride from the city center.
